The United States: The Epicenter of Casino Culture
In the United States, casinos are more than just places to gamble; they are entertainment hubs. Las Vegas, known as the gambling capital of the world, boasts a dazzling array of casinos that offer everything from high-stakes poker to extravagant performances. Despite its reputation for excess, the city is also home to a burgeoning online gambling sector, making it accessible for those who prefer to wager from the comfort of their homes.
Atlantic City, another key player in the U.S. casino market, has a distinct charm defined by its boardwalk and beachfront casinos. While it may not match the glitz of Las Vegas, Atlantic City offers a unique blend of history and modern gambling experiences, attracting visitors all year round.

Asia: A Gaming Powerhouse
In contrast, Asia is emerging as the new powerhouse in the global casino scene. Countries like Macau and Singapore have become attractive destinations for high rollers and tourists alike. Macau, often referred to as the “Gambling capital of the world,” has surpassed Las Vegas in terms of gaming revenue, showcasing the continent’s growing influence in the gambling industry.
Macau: The Las Vegas of the East
Macau’s casinos are nothing short of spectacular, featuring lavish designs and an array of entertainment options. The Venetian Macao, for instance, offers gondola rides and diverse dining options alongside its gaming floors. This blend of luxury and excitement has positioned Macau as a must-visit for casino enthusiasts.
Singapore: A New Player on the Block
In recent years, Singapore has made significant strides in the casino industry with the opening of integrated resorts like Marina Bay Sands and Resorts World Sentosa. These establishments combine gaming with hospitality and entertainment, drawing millions of visitors annually. The strict regulations ensure a safe and enjoyable environment for both locals and tourists.
Brazil: A Rapidly Evolving Scene
Though gambling was banned in Brazil for decades, recent legislative changes are paving the way for a state-controlled casino industry. This development is expected to attract foreign investment and tourism, transforming Brazil into a competitive player on the global casino stage. As the country prepares to embrace gambling, the potential for growth in its casino scene is enormous.
